    Do you enjoy kids, nature, regenerative agriculture, holistic wellbeing?
    We run a non profit country school. This is a very small start up alternative education program that works with homeschoolers and kids who need nature enrichment in their school week. We are a place-based farm school learning with a focus on regenerative agriculture.

    Current help Needed:

    DIY help - creating shelving, building a natural playground, building a posh chicken coup, tree houses, and forts.
    Bushcraft + Primitive survival skills to help with Forest Friday
    Tree net weavers
    Playful souls that enjoy working with youth and learning about regenerative agriculture.

    How are you at organising and tidying? We are doing a deep clean and shedding in the house/storerooms and need help through this process.

    General house help / help in the garden / tidying up and re-sorting a load of clutter.

    The Trust Gardens -
    Our trust is run out of our property in Upper Hutt. Currently, the gardens are a hot mess and we need to do some landscaping to get them back up to scratch.

    Organizer Extraordinaire-
    Someone to help organize and put order to things. So if you love the Konmarie method and the idea of getting rid of clutter and creating order out of chaos gets your blood warming and your hands rubbing together then we could use your brilliance.

    Photographer or videographer or graphics designer? - Great we always need extra help here too on some of our smaller trust projects. Recording content and editing...you are our sort of person.

    Ambivert? Social Introvert?
    We have a lovely room in our home but we are looking for someone specific. We are looking for an ambivert/introvert who is happy with their own company but can also communicate and socialize a bit (we are an ambivert and an introvert so highly extroverted people overwhelm us).
    You need to have a good sense of humour and be compassionate. A strong work ethic and a desire to leave the world better than when you found it.

    We have lots of books mostly of a Buddhist /Taoist, or non-fiction photography and filmmaking and self-development variety.

    Part of your chores will be to keep the house clean and tidy. Help with cooking too.

    There are miles and miles of walking trails around us and we have a beautiful home and a section on a river with an organic garden.

    We work in Collaboration with the farm that hosts Earth School and sometimes workaways will stay there. It depends on if you want more of a social scene. If so the farm is a better home but you will be likely pulled into farm specific work as well as working with the kids.

    We need help keeping the house in order while we run the Charitable Trust + Photography Studio.
    Daily chores may involve:
    - Feeding the Animals
    - Tidying the studio and house (vacuum, dust, put props away)
    - Helping with Meal Preparation
    - Gardening (if its nice weather for it)
    We also need project specific help which just depends on what is happening creatively at the time and what your unique skill sets are.
